My sister and her husband were visiting Darwin and we took them out on a sunset cruise on the Cape Adieu. It was the most wonderful night - we were seated on the top deck at the stern and had a wonderful view, delicious food and excellent music interspersed with informative commentary about the sights we sailed past. The weather was perfect and the crew were organised and attentive. This was the best outing we have ever had in our 2 years in Darwin. We will take all our visitors on this cruise in future.
